How to sell in China with Weibo Store?
Sina Weibo is one of the major Chinese microblogging social platforms that offer a very wide variety of features. There are more than 500 million monthly active users in China in 2021. Weibo can be considered as a mix of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ram. In this platform, users can open personal accounts, follow and be followed by other users, publish textual and visual content, stay updated on the latest news by following the so-called “hot topics” and watch live streaming.

Youku Tudou a digital success story – Update 2020
Youku Tudou, a leading multi-screen video entertainment and media company in China has announced its unaudited financial results for the second quarter of 2015. The results are overwhelmingly positive; Youku (akin to American YouTube) has proved to be a landmark digital success story in China. Youku is a large-scale video-sharing website under the Alibaba Group. The website was initially established very similar to YouTube and appeared as a video-sharing platform. However, it has gradually transformed into an online media platform, especially holding a large number of videos and audio copyrights and other special broadcasting rights, and involved in the production of movies and TV series. There is already a big difference in the business direction of YouTube.

How to leverage Kuaishou Marketing for e-commerce purposes?
Kuaishou, often translated as “crystal” or “mirror,” is a Chinese social media platform that has quickly gained popularity in recent years. The app allows users to share photos and videos with each other, and many people use it to showcase their talents or simply share funny moments they’ve experienced. Kuaishou is the biggest competitor of Douyin (Tik Tok).

Understanding Douyin Marketing: Chinese Tik Tok for Business Guide
Douyin, known as China’s TikTok, has seen immense growth since its launch in 2016. The app now boasts an impressive 500 million monthly active Douyin users and continues to grow bigger by the day! Companies such as Alibaba, Xiaomi, and JingDong are among those who have taken advantage of Douyin’s large audience base and a huge amount of traffic. It is no longer only a space for people to enjoy sharing moments or bloggers promoting products; big businesses have tapped into this platform with great success!
